Comprehending the UK Driving License Categories

Before diving into the application procedure, it is vital to comprehend the various classifications of driving licenses offered in the UK:

Provisional License

A provisionary license permits individuals to find out to drive and is the essential initial step for new drivers.

Key Features:

  • Valid for up to 10 years
  • Allows drivers to experiment an approved trainer or a qualified driver over 21
  • Must show 'L' plates on the lorry

Complete License

As soon as individuals have actually passed their driving exam, they can request a complete driving license, permitting them to drive unaided.

Key Features:

  • Valid indefinitely, based on renewal requirements
  • Various classifications based upon car types (e.g., motorbikes, cars, heavy cars)

Categories of Vehicles

Depending on the specific driving license held, individuals may be qualified to run numerous kinds of cars:

  • Category A: Motorcycles
  • Category B: Cars
  • Classification C: Large automobiles (trucks)
  • Category D: Buses

Step-by-Step Process to Obtain a Driving License

Getting a UK driving license involves a number of important steps, which are laid out as follows:

1. Obtain a Provisional License

The journey begins by using for a provisionary license, which can be done online or by means of a postal application.

Requirements:

  • Age: Must be at least 15 years and 9 months old
  • Identity Verification: UK residency evidence (passport, energy costs)
  • Payment of Fee: Typically around ₤ 34 online or ₤ 43 by post

2. Prepare for the Theory Test

Once the provisional license is obtained, aiming drivers need to get ready for the theory test, which examines their understanding of UK roadway signs, guidelines, and regulations.

Preparation Tips:

  • Use the official DVSA app or books to study
  • Practice mock tests offered online
  • Arrange a test date through the DVSA site

3. Take the Theory Test

The theory test makes up two elements: multiple-choice concerns and a risk perception test.

Bottom line:

  • Candidates need to pass both sections to continue to the useful driving test
  • The cost of the theory test is roughly ₤ 23

4. Practical Driving Lessons

After passing the theory test, the next step includes taking useful driving lessons with a qualified instructor.

Recommendations:

  • Take lessons with an Approved Driving Instructor (ADI)
  • Aim for at least 20-40 hours of practical lessons, depending on specific capabilities
  • Practice regularly with a qualified driver

5. Pass the Practical Driving Test

When the trainer thinks the prospect is all set, they can reserve their useful driving test.

Test Components:

  • An eyesight test
  • Automobile security questions (revealing understanding of the automobile)
  • On-road driving skills assessment within a set time frame

6. Get Your Full Driving License

Upon effectively passing the practical test, prospects can apply for their complete driving license. If qualified, the trainer will submit the essential documentation electronically, or prospects can apply straight through the DVLA.

Requirements:

  • Payment of the required costs (approx. ₤ 34 for online applications)
  • Provide a passport-sized photo, if not digitally submitted

Extra Considerations

Medical Requirements

Certain drivers, especially those with medical conditions, might need to reveal their health status. This might include extra evaluations before getting a license.

Rejection of License

There are specific circumstances under which a license application can be declined, consisting of:

  • Failure to fulfill proposed age limits
  • Previous disqualifications due to driving offenses
  • Medical reasons that might impair driving ability

FAQs

What is the minimum age to get a provisional license in the UK?

The minimum age to look for a provisionary driving license is 15 years and 9 months old.

The length of time does it require to get a driving license in the UK?

The timeline can vary considerably based on personal readiness, availability of driving test slots, and other elements. On average, it may take a number of months to complete the procedure, from getting a provisional license to passing the practical test.

Can I drive without a complete driving license in the UK?

No, it is illegal to drive an automobile without a legitimate complete driving license. Nevertheless, provisional license holders can practice driving under specific guidelines, such as being accompanied by a qualified driver.

What takes place if I fail my useful driving test?

Candidates can retake the useful test after a waiting period. It is recommended to take additional lessons to enhance before attempting the test again.
